Abstract

The substances heap in storage requires good air flow to keep condition of the substances; particularly they are sensitive substances to specific properties of air that flow around it such as velocity and pressure. Commonly, properties of air in storage flow with low velocity and pressure that called with ?aeration flow?. At this article, an analysis have done to two-dimensions aeration flow of substances heap modelling in storage where position of inlet aeration at middle-top boundary and position of outlet aeration at left-bottom and right-bottom boundaries. Analysis done by focused to distribution of aeration volume flow rate using numerical analysis as potential flow with finite difference method. Distribution of aeration volume flow rate that determined from various of substances height to storage height percentage make different aeration flow contour. A substance height to storage height percentage that makes level of uniformity of colours that almost flattens of aeration flow contour is a compatible variable in placing substances in storage.
